What are some popular legal thriller fiction books?

One popular legal thriller is 'The Firm' by John Grisham. It's about a young lawyer who joins a prestigious law firm and discovers some dark secrets. Another is 'Presumed Innocent' by Scott Turow, which involves a prosecutor who becomes the prime suspect in a murder case. And 'A Time to Kill' by John Grisham as well, where a black father takes justice into his own hands after his daughter is brutally attacked.

What are the top legal fiction books?

One of the top legal fiction books is 'To Kill a Mockingbird' by Harper Lee. It deals with racial injustice and the legal system in a small southern town. The story, told through the eyes of a young girl, shows how a lawyer, Atticus Finch, defends a black man wrongly accused of a crime. Another great one is 'The Firm' by John Grisham. It follows a young lawyer who joins a seemingly prestigious law firm only to discover its dark secrets. The legal thriller aspect keeps readers on the edge of their seats.

Are free online fiction books legal?

In general, it depends on the source. If the books are from a legitimate source like a library's digital collection or a site dedicated to public domain works, then they are legal. For instance, Librivox offers free audiobook versions of public domain fiction books legally. But if you come across a site that seems sketchy and is offering copyrighted books for free without authorization, that's not legal.
